Understanding Roof Rack Weight Capacity
The weight capacity of a roof rack is determined by several factors, including the type of vehicle, the rack’s design and materials, and the method of attachment. It is essential to note that the weight capacity of a roof rack is not the same as the weight of the items you plan to carry. The weight capacity refers to the maximum weight that the rack can safely support without compromising the structural integrity of the vehicle or the rack itself.
Vehicle-Specific Factors
The vehicle’s roof structure, including the type of roof and its material, plays a significant role in determining the weight capacity of the roof rack. For example, a vehicle with a steel roof can generally support more weight than one with a fiberglass or aluminum roof. Additionally, vehicles with a panoramic sunroof or moonroof may have a lower weight capacity due to the weaker roof structure.
Rack Design and Materials
The design and materials used in the roof rack also impact its weight capacity. Aluminum and steel racks are generally stronger and more durable than those made from plastic or fiberglass. Furthermore, racks with a wide, flat base and multiple attachment points can distribute the weight more evenly, reducing the stress on the vehicle’s roof.

What factors determine the weight capacity of a roof rack?
The weight capacity of a roof rack is determined by several factors, including the type and quality of the rack, the vehicle’s roof structure, and the distribution of weight on the rack. A good quality roof rack is designed to distribute the weight evenly across the roof, but the vehicle’s roof structure also plays a crucial role in determining the overall weight capacity. The roof’s material, thickness, and curvature all impact its ability to support weight. Additionally, the weight capacity may be affected by the type of crossbars used, as well as the spacing and configuration of the rack’s components.
To determine the weight capacity of a roof rack, it’s essential to consult the manufacturer’s specifications and guidelines. The manufacturer will typically provide a weight capacity rating, which is the maximum weight that the rack is designed to hold. This rating may be expressed in terms of a total weight limit or a weight limit per crossbar. It’s also important to note that the weight capacity may vary depending on the specific vehicle and roof type. For example, a roof rack installed on a vehicle with a fiberglass roof may have a lower weight capacity than the same rack installed on a vehicle with a metal roof. How do I calculate the total weight of my roof rack load?
Calculating the total weight of a roof rack load involves adding up the weights of all the items to be carried, including luggage, equipment, and any additional accessories. It’s essential to be accurate and thorough in this calculation, as exceeding the weight capacity can pose a safety risk. Start by weighing each item individually, using a scale or consulting the manufacturer’s specifications. Then, add up the weights of all the items to determine the total weight. Be sure to include the weight of any straps, buckles, or other securing devices, as these can also contribute to the overall weight.
In addition to calculating the total weight, it’s also important to consider the distribution of weight on the roof rack. A well-distributed load will help to ensure safe and stable transportation. To achieve this, it’s recommended to place the heaviest items at the center of the rack, with lighter items towards the edges. It’s also a good idea to secure the load using straps or tie-downs, to prevent shifting or movement during transit. What are the consequences of exceeding the weight capacity of a roof rack?
Exceeding the weight capacity of a roof rack can have serious consequences, including damage to the vehicle’s roof, the rack itself, and the items being carried. The excess weight can cause the roof to bend or warp, leading to costly repairs or even compromising the structural integrity of the vehicle. The rack may also be damaged, with crossbars bending or breaking under the strain. In addition, the items being carried may be damaged or lost, particularly if they are not properly secured. In extreme cases, exceeding the weight capacity can even lead to accidents or injuries, especially if the load shifts or falls during transit.
